Studying Online at Dominican University of California

Online coursework is an option at Dominican University of California. Among 1,900 students, 141 (7%) were enrolled entirely in distance education and 56 (3%) took at least some classes online.

Student Demographics & Diversity

The following sections describe the student demographics for Public Health Education & Promotion graduates at Dominican University of California, by degree type.

Across all degree levels, Public Health Education & Promotion graduates at Dominican University of California are 57% women (4) and 43% men (3).

Public Health Education & Promotion Bachelor’s Program at Dominican University of California

Among the 7 bachelor’s public health education & promotion graduates at Dominican University of California, 57% were women (4) and 43% were men (3).
